| +// Copyright (c) 2009 The Chromium Authors. All rights reserved.
|
| +// Use of this source code is governed by a BSD-style license that can be
|
| +// found in the LICENSE file.
|
| +
|
| +#ifndef NET_HTTP_PARTIAL_DATA_H_
|
| +#define NET_HTTP_PARTIAL_DATA_H_
|
| +
|
| +#include "base/basictypes.h"
|
| +#include "net/base/completion_callback.h"
|
| +#include "net/http/http_byte_range.h"
|
| +
|
| +namespace disk_cache {
|
| +class Entry;
|
| +}
|
| +
|
| +namespace net {
|
| +
|
| +class IOBuffer;
|
| +
|
| +// This class provides support for dealing with range requests and the
|
| +// subsequent partial-content responses. We use sparse cache entries to store
|
| +// these requests. This class is tightly integrated with HttpCache::Transaction
|
| +// and it is intended to allow a cleaner implementation of that class.
|
| +//
|
| +// In order to fulfill range requests, we may have to perform a sequence of
|
| +// reads from the cache, interleaved with reads from the network / writes to the
|
| +// cache. This class basically keeps track of the data required to perform each
|
| +// of those individual network / cache requests.
|
| +class PartialData {
|
| + public:
|
| + PartialData() : range_present_(false), final_range_(false) {}
|
| + ~PartialData() {}
|
| +
|
| + // Performs initialization of the object by parsing the request |headers|
|
| + // and verifying that we can process the requested range. Returns true if
|
| + // we can process the requested range, and false otherwise. |new_headers| is
|
| + // a subset of the request extra headers, with byte-range related headers
|
| + // removed so that we can easily add any byte-range that we need.
|
| + bool Init(const std::string& headers, const std::string& new_headers);
|
| +
|
| + // Restores the byte-range header that was removed during Init(), by appending
|
| + // the data to the provided |headers|.
|
| + void RestoreHeaders(std::string* headers) const;
|
| +
|
| + // Builds the required |headers| to perform the proper cache validation for
|
| + // the next range to be fetched. Returns 0 when there is no need to perform
|
| + // more operations because we reached the end of the request (so 0 bytes
|
| + // should be actually returned to the user), a positive number to indicate
|
| + // that |headers| should be used to validate the cache, or an appropriate
|
| + // error code.
|
| + int PrepareCacheValidation(disk_cache::Entry* entry, std::string* headers);
|
| +
|
| + // Returns true if the current range is stored in the cache.
|
| + bool IsCurrentRangeCached() const;
|
| +
|
| + // Returns true if the current range is the last one needed to fulfill the
|
| + // user's request.
|
| + bool IsLastRange() const;
|
| +
|
| + // Reads up to |data_len| bytes from the cache and stores them in the provided
|
| + // buffer (|data|). Basically, this is just a wrapper around the API of the
|
| + // cache that provides the right arguments for the current range. When the IO
|
| + // operation completes, OnCacheReadCompleted() must be called with the result
|
| + // of the operation.
|
| + int CacheRead(disk_cache::Entry* entry, IOBuffer* data, int data_len,
|
| + CompletionCallback* callback);
|
| +
|
| + // Writes |data_len| bytes to cache. This is basically a wrapper around the
|
| + // API of the cache that provides the right arguments for the current range.
|
| + int CacheWrite(disk_cache::Entry* entry, IOBuffer* data, int data_len,
|
| + CompletionCallback* callback);
|
| +
|
| + // This method should be called when CacheRead() finishes the read, to update
|
| + // the internal state about the current range.
|
| + void OnCacheReadCompleted(int result);
|
| +
|
| + // This method should be called after receiving data from the network, to
|
| + // update the internal state about the current range.
|
| + void OnNetworkReadCompleted(int result);
|
| +
|
| + private:
|
| + static void AddRangeHeader(int64 start, int64 end, std::string* headers);
|
| +
|
| + int64 current_range_start_;
|
| + int64 cached_start_;
|
| + int cached_min_len_;
|
| + HttpByteRange byte_range_; // The range requested by the user.
|
| + std::string extra_headers_; // The clean set of extra headers (no ranges).
|
| + bool range_present_; // True if next range entry is already stored.
|
| + bool final_range_;
|
| +
|
| + DISALLOW_COPY_AND_ASSIGN(PartialData);
|
| +};
|
| +
|
| +} // namespace net
|
| +
|
| +#endif // NET_HTTP_PARTIAL_DATA_H_
